Use this list of Data Architect interview questions and answers to gain better insight into your candidates, and make better hiring decisions.
When interviewing for a Data Architect position, it's crucial to assess the candidate's technical expertise, problem-solving skills, and ability to design scalable data solutions. Look for creativity, a deep understanding of data management, and the ability to communicate complex concepts effectively.
Check out the Data Architect job description template
To understand the candidate's methodology and thought process in creating data architectures.
Sample answer
I start by gathering requirements from stakeholders, then create a high-level design, ensuring scalability and performance. I also consider data security and compliance from the get-go.
To gauge the candidate's experience with database optimization and problem-solving skills.
Sample answer
I once optimized a slow-performing database by indexing key columns, partitioning large tables, and rewriting inefficient queries. The performance improved by 50%!
To assess the candidate's attention to detail and commitment to maintaining high data standards.
Sample answer
I implement data validation rules, use ETL processes to clean data, and regularly audit data quality. Consistent monitoring is key to maintaining integrity.
To understand the candidate's experience with data integration and their ability to manage complex data environments.
Sample answer
I use ETL tools to extract, transform, and load data from various sources, ensuring consistency and accuracy. I also set up automated workflows to streamline the process.
To evaluate the candidate's knowledge of data security practices and regulatory compliance.
Sample answer
I implement encryption, access controls, and regular security audits. Staying updated with regulations like GDPR and HIPAA is also crucial.
To see if the candidate is proactive about continuous learning and staying current in their field.
Sample answer
I follow industry blogs, attend webinars, and participate in professional forums. Continuous learning is essential in this ever-evolving field.
To assess the candidate's communication skills and ability to simplify complex concepts.
Sample answer
Sure! Imagine our data as a library. The database is the library, tables are the bookshelves, and rows are the books. Each book has a unique ID, like a library card number.
To understand the candidate's approach to designing scalable solutions.
Sample answer
I design with scalability in mind, using techniques like sharding, partitioning, and distributed databases. Regular performance testing helps ensure the architecture can handle growth.
To learn about the candidate's preferred tools and their rationale behind these choices.
Sample answer
I prefer using ER/Studio for data modeling due to its robust features and user-friendly interface. For database management, I often use SQL Server and PostgreSQL.
To assess the candidate's experience with data migration and their ability to manage complex transitions.
Sample answer
I start with a thorough analysis of the legacy system, then plan the migration in phases. Using ETL tools, I ensure data integrity and minimal downtime during the transition.
Look out for these red flags when interviewing candidates for this role:
Introducing Mega HR, the AI-first hiring platform powered by Megan, the most advanced, human-quality AI recruiter.